一种船舶与海洋工程项目管理系统技术方案

技术编号:10075676 阅读:186 留言:0更新日期:2014-05-24 05:59
本发明专利技术公开了一种基于船舶与海洋工程项目的管理系统,属于管理系统,其中,包括用户角色模块、角色信息树状显示模块、侦听输出模块;用户角色模块包括用户角色设定子模块、用户信息存储子模块;用户角色设定子模块与用户信息存储子模块连接;用户信息存储子模块包括用户编号、用户角色编号;侦听输出模块连接于用户角色模块和角色信息树状显示模块之间;角色信息树状显示模块包括不同角色信息的树状显示,用户信息存储子模块中的不同用户编号和用户角色编号组对应不同的角色信息的树状显示。本发明专利技术的有益效果是:通过基于每个用户在项目中承担的固定角色,简化了显示内容,降低了系统的使用操作难度,提高了工作效率,减少了信息系统的培训成本。

【技术实现步骤摘要】

本专利技术涉及一种管理系统,尤其涉及一种基于船舶与海洋工程项目的管理系统。
技术介绍
船舶与海洋工程项目管理是十分复杂的管理过程,其基本特征是设计过程是一个螺旋式上升的过程,设计参数和技术状态的确定是一个逐步明确的过程,这就给船舶与海洋工程项目管理带来很大的复杂性,因此船舶与海洋工程项目管理的信息化具有很大的技术难度。当一个新的项目开始时,在生产部门负责人的统一指挥下,各个基层生产单位负责人选派专业技术负责人及其助手参与到项目的技术团队中,构成项目技术团队,同时项目的职能管理部门负责人选派项目管理员参与到项目中构成完整的项目团队。在项目中各个角色承担着不同的职责,同时又相互合作,共同完成一个项目。从上分析,员工角色承担的职责比较简单,专业主任设计师承担着该专业的技术管理职责,而科长则要对整个科负责,对该科承担的所有项目负责,项目管理员则起到在各个专业科之间协调的作用,部门领导则要从宏观上把握项目的各方面进展。因此各个角色承担的职责有很大的差异,如果所有功能都呈现给用户,用户的管理系统将非常复杂,用户的使用也将变得十分困难,培训成本会非常高。同时由于很多数据需要隔离,系统的开发维护难度也将非常高。目前国内外尚无成熟的针对首制船或新产品开发的信息化系统。
技术实现思路
    为了解决上述的船舶与海洋工程项目管理中存在的开发、维护难度大、管理使用困难等技术问题,本专利技术提供了一种基于用户角色的船舶与海洋工程项目信息化管理系统。    一种船舶与海洋工程项目管理系统,其中,包括用户角色模块、角色信息树状显示模块、侦听输出模块;所述用户角色模块包括用户角色设定子模块、用户信息存储子模块;所述用户角色设定子模块与所述用户信息存储子模块连接;所述用户信息存储子模块包括用户编号、用户角色编号;所述侦听输出模块连接于所述用户角色模块和所述角色信息树状显示模块之间;所述角色信息树状显示模块包括不同角色信息的树状显示,所述用户信息存储子模块中的不同用户编号和用户角色编号组对应不同的角色信息的树状显示。    上述的基于船舶与海洋工程项目的管理系统,其中,所述用户角色模块还包括用户角色删减子模块,所述所述用户角色删减子模块与所述用户信息存储模块连接。    上述的基于船舶与海洋工程项目的管理系统,其中,所述用户角色设定子模块包括用户角色名称自定义单元。    上述的基于船舶与海洋工程项目的管理系统,其中,所述用户角色模块还包括用户角色选择子模块,所述用户角色选择子模块与所述用户角色信息存储子模块连结。本技术方案的有益效果是:通过基于每个用户的固定角色,使得当用户选择其中的一个角色时,系统只呈现与该角色有关的内容,从而大幅简化了显示内容,降低了系统的使用操作难度,增加了工作效率,减少了信息系统的培训成本。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术一种基于船舶与海洋工程项目的管理系统的实施例的结构示意图。具体实施方式下面结合附图和具体实施例对本专利技术作进一步说明,但不作为本专利技术的限定。如图1所示,为本专利技术一种基于船舶与海洋工程项目的管理系统的实施例的结构示意图,其中包括用户角色模块、角色信息树状显示模块、侦听输出模块;用户角色模块包括用户角色设定子模块、用户角色删减子模块、用户信息存储子模块;用户角色设定子模块、用户角色删减子模块与用户信息存储子模块连接。可以通过用户角色设定子模块、用户角色删减子模块对用户应该拥有的角色进行定义,包括删除角色和设定角色两个功能。在本专利技术一种基于船舶与海洋工程项目的管理系统的具体实施例中,用户角色包括员工、专业主任设计师、专业科科长、计划科科长、计划科项目管理员、部门领导6个角色,根据项目管理的要求,本专利技术可以在此基础上进一步扩展用户角色。管理系统在用户角色模块中通过用户信息存储子模块记录每个用户的角色。其中主要包括:数据项编号,用于区分每个记录;用户编号,用于区分每个不同的用户;用户角色编号,分别对应于员工、专业主任设计师、专业科科长、计划科科长、计划科项目管理员、部门领导6个角色。角色信息树状显示模块包括不同角色信息的树状显示,用户信息存储子模块中的不同用户编号和用户角色编号组对应于角色信息树状显示模块中不同角色信息的树状显示。例如,角色编号对应为计划科科长时,其对应于角色信息树状显示模块中角色信息树状显示包括包括船型/项目末班管理按钮、项目基础设置管理按钮、实动工时管理按钮、项目进度管理按钮、送退审管理按钮、消息管理按钮、报表管理按钮、设计过程管理按钮等内容。而在项目基础管理按钮下,又可再分为打开项目子按钮、设置项目设计阶段子按钮、设置专业图纸目录子按钮、设置项目设校审人员子按钮等内容。角色信息树状显示的最底层末端节点对应于不同的用户编号均分别包括有其各自的信息列表。侦听输出模块连接于用户角色模块和角色信息树状显示模块,用于在界面上获得并记录下用户的角色,同时根据用户的角色,在传入用户选择的角色编号后,动态加载对应的用户角色树状显示。本专利技术的技术原理是:通过基于角色的动态树状显示,对每个用户的不同角色信息进行动态的显示,因此解决了在管理系统中的管理复杂性问题,使得整个管理系统的操作使用变得十分容易,降低了开发维护的成本。优选的,用户角色设定子模块包括用户角色名称自定义单元。由于各个企业的特色不同,以上角色在企业中的习惯称谓有很大不同,如有些企业主任设计师的称谓为主管设计师等。因此系统需要针对这种情况单独定义企业的习惯称谓。为此可以在用户角色设定子模块中设定一个用户角色名称自定义单元,该用户角色自定义单元可以根据用户的实际需要对用户的角色名称进行自定义设定,其中存储有记录编号信息,用户角色编号信息,以及企业中的自定义名称,这样通过界面定义了习惯称谓后,各个企业应用时可以更好地适应企业的实际情况,减少培训的投入。优选的,其中,用户角色模块还包括用户角色选择子模块,用户角色选择子模块与用户角色信息存储子模块连结用户可以根据角色选择框选择系统赋予该用户的角色,从而快速实现界面的切换,这样不同的用户拥有不同的角色,每个用户的界面复杂性是完全不一样的。对于绝大部分用户来说,只有一个角色,对少部分用户来说,则可能还会有其他一些角色,使用复杂性相对较高。通过用户角色的选择切换功能使得培训可以集中在少部分用户上,节约了培训时间,也有利于提升培训的效果。此时,侦听输出模块在获得了用户的角色定义集后,会通过侦听响应用户所选择的角色,并通过角色信息树状显示模块加载该角色的的信息树状显示。通过使用本专利技术一种基于船舶与海洋工程项目的管理系统的实施例,可以对船舶与海洋工程项目的工程项目和人员进行信息化的管理,使得系统的功能划分简明清楚,便于对系统的操作使用,有利于减少运行成本,本文档来自技高网...

【技术保护点】
一种船舶与海洋工程项目管理系统,其特征在于,包括用户角色模块、角色信息树状显示模块、侦听输出模块;所述用户角色模块包括用户角色设定子模块、用户信息存储子模块;所述用户角色设定子模块与所述用户信息存储子模块连接;所述用户信息存储子模块包括用户编号、用户角色编号;所述侦听输出模块连接于所述用户角色模块和所述角色信息树状显示模块之间;所述角色信息树状显示模块包括不同角色信息的树状显示,所述用户信息存储子模块中的不同的用户编号和用户角色编号组对应不同的角色信息的树状显示。

【技术特征摘要】
1.一种船舶与海洋工程项目管理系统,其特征在于,
包括用户角色模块、角色信息树状显示模块、侦听输出模块;
所述用户角色模块包括用户角色设定子模块、用户信息存储子模块;所述用户角色设定子模块与所述用户信息存储子模块连接;
所述用户信息存储子模块包括用户编号、用户角色编号;
所述侦听输出模块连接于所述用户角色模块和所述角色信息树状显示模块之间;
所述角色信息树状显示模块包括不同角色信息的树状显示,所述用户信息存储子模块中的不同的用户编号和用户角色编号组对应不同的角...

【专利技术属性】
技术研发人员:管伟元蔡鸿明韩明倪明杰朱建璋戴菁
申请(专利权)人:中国船舶工业集团公司七〇八研究所
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1